When considering incorporating a waist trainer into your routine, it's essential to understand how to use it effectively. Here are some tips to get started:
  • Choose the right size: A proper fit is crucial for comfort and effectiveness. Measure your waist and refer to sizing charts.
  • Start slow: If you are new to waist training, begin by wearing it for a few hours a day and gradually increase the duration.
  • Combine with exercise: For optimal results, pair waist training with regular physical activity and a balanced diet.
  • Stay hydrated: Drink plenty of water to keep your body hydrated while wearing a waist trainer.
  • Listen to your body: If you experience discomfort, adjust the fit or duration of wear.

FAQs

To choose the best waist trainer, consider your body shape, size, and the level of compression you desire. Look for adjustable options and read customer reviews for insights on fit and comfort.

Key features to consider include material quality, size options, level of compression, and design elements like boning or hooks for support and adjustability.

Common mistakes include choosing the wrong size, opting for overly tight garments, and neglecting to consider comfort during wear.

It is recommended to start with a few hours a day and gradually increase the duration based on your comfort level. Listening to your body is key.

Waist trainers can aid in achieving a desired silhouette but should be used in conjunction with a healthy diet and exercise for effective weight management.
